Botanical Name: Tropaeolum nanum
|
|
|
|
|
Type: Annual. Lives just one year. Grows quickly, blooms heavily, dies with first frost. Can regrow following spring if seed falls on bare ground.
|
|
|
Color: Double blooms in yellow, orange, and deep red.
|
|
|
|
|
Bloom Time: Days to germinate: 6-15 depending on soil and weather conditions. Days to maturity: 60. (summer until frost)
|
|
|
Sun/Shade: Full sun to partial shade
|
|
|
Soil Preferences: Adaptable.
|
|
|
Moisture Requirements: Average moisture, well drained.
|
|
|
Where To Grow It: All regions of North America
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
Indigenous To: Mexico and South America
